Understanding the Significance of ISO 55001

It addresses asset management principles. It explains the system requirements through which businesses can establish and maintain the recognized asset management system (AMS). These assets encompass transmission and distribution networks. It may include digital infrastructure, transformers, and energy storage systems. Let’s understand the significance-

Aging Infrastructure

A significant proportion of this sector relies on infrastructure. The deterioration of assets can lead to equipment failure and similar issues. This may result in service disruptions. ISO 55001 enables businesses to advance with proactive maintenance approaches.

Energy Transition

The use of renewable energy introduces new types of assets. It also brings operational complexities. It may include solar installations to battery storage systems. All these things demand distinct management methodologies. This standard provides a versatile framework.

Risk Mitigation

Energy companies must adhere to compliance requirements. Establishing ISO 55001 standards promotes systematic risk management practices and transparency. It empowers firms to identify and mitigate risks confidently. This is critical for better asset performance.

Cost Efficiency

Asset-intensive industries often face the challenge of expenditures for operations and buying equipment. Establishing the recognized standards helps these firms make informed decisions. They can utilize assets in their complete lifecycle that optimize cost structures.

Core Principles of ISO 55001 for Power and Energy Sectors

Alignment with the Firm’s Strategy

Asset management objectives can be aligned with a strategic vision. These companies can meet their business objectives. This includes improving grid reliability and reducing carbon emissions.

Lifecycle-Oriented Asset Management

Effective asset management is critical for the entire asset lifecycle. This includes initial design, maintenance, and lots more. This is how it enhances the overall asset performance.

Risk-Based Decision-Making

Businesses can value decision-making and eliminate risks. This standard helps them prioritize maintenance activities.

Tips for ISO 55001 Implementation in the Power Sector

The implementation process demands higher engagement from firms. The structured approach includes-

  • Comprehensive evaluation of asset management practices.
  • Identify deficiencies to prioritize initiatives for ISO 55001 asset lifecycle management.
  • Value strong leadership to establish clear asset management policies.
  • Develop robust systems for storing and analyzing data.
  • Integrate practices with other standards like ISO 9001 to meet objectives.

Note that successful adoption is essential. Training programs for employees are thus suggested. It helps embed ISO principles with precision into daily operations.

ISO 55001 Asset Management Certification Challenges and Key Considerations

Establishing the recognized standards might seem easy. However, many businesses struggle to understand the requirements. They find difficulties in interpreting principles and make unknown errors. Thus, working with experts is suggested to tackle these unknown obstacles in a confident manner. These certified professionals also clear your doubts.

Just to make you familiar, the most popular challenges include-

Complex Assets : Managing geographically dispersed assets is a complicated task.

Employee Resistance : Transitioning to a proactive asset management needs proper employee awareness.

Initial Investment Requirements : Firms must value upfront investments in systems for long-term gains.

Digital Initiatives : Ensure seamless integration with digital initiatives such as AI-driven analytics.
